5/5/2013 2:00 PM - 3:00 PM (Non-Profit Public Events) Free Water Ski Show
Location: Ski-A-Rees Stadium located on City Island 2013 Winter show season will begin on Feb. 3rd and run every Sunday through May 19th. Admission to show is free. Watch in awe as we dazzle you with thrilling jumps and tricks, breathtaking pyramids, beautiful ballet and swivel lines, doubles, trios, skiing barefoot and many more feats that will surely entertain the entire family. It's always fun and always free! Established in 1957, the Sarasota Ski-A-Rees is a non-profit organization open to anyone interested in learning about and developing skills related to water skiing, water safety. With the ongoing support of the City of Sarasota, the Ski-A-Rees have been able to present free weekly water ski shows that have become a Sarasota tradition for 56 years.

5/6/2013 2:30 PM - 8:30 PM (City Hall) Regular City Commission Meeting
Location: Commission Chambers, City Hall - 1565 1st. Street Regular Commission Meetings are scheduled for the first and third Monday of each month, or Tuesday if Monday is a holiday. The meeting begins at 2:30 pm, recesses at 4:30 pm, and reconvenes at 6:00 pm. Public input is welcomed. 5/16/2013 3:00 PM - 5:00 PM (City Hall) Parks Recreation & Environmental Protection Board
Meeting Location: City Hall, Commission Chambers
A citizens advisory board on parks, recreation and environmental protection issues dealing within the City of Sarasota. All are welcome to attend. If you wish to speak before board, please complete a Request to Speak form. Citizens' input concerning City topics have a three minute time limit. Meetings are held bi-monthly on the third Thursday, except July.
